Older Victorian and early 20th-century homes in Columbus's riverside districts do present additional challenges because their aged wood frames, plaster walls, and multiple layers of wallpaper create more harborage points for bed bugs to hide. The settling and gaps common in homes of this age also make it harder to achieve complete pest control without professional treatment. However, bed bugs are equally problematic in newer ranch and suburban homes; age alone doesn't determine riskβit's more about entry routes, occupant travel, and how quickly an infestation is detected and treated. Early inspection is especially important in older Columbus homes because structural complexity can delay discovery.
Heat treatment raises room temperature to 118Β°F+, killing all bed bugs and eggs in a single visit with no chemicals. Chemical treatment uses EPA-registered pesticides applied to hiding spots over 2β3 visits. For severe infestations, combination treatment (both methods) delivers the highest success rate.
Preparation depends on the treatment type. Heat treatment requires minimal prep β mostly clearing highly flammable items and pets. Chemical treatment requires washing and bagging bedding, clearing under beds, and temporary relocation for a few hours.
Heat treatment: you can return the same day once the space has cooled, usually 2β4 hours after treatment. Chemical treatment: you'll need to stay out for 4 hours minimum after the tech leaves.

Budget motels along major highway corridors like I-295 in Burlington County are common bed bug introduction points. Don't wait to see a full infestation develop β inspect your luggage and put all travel clothing through a high-heat dryer cycle right away. If bites continue after a few days, book a home inspection to catch the problem early before it spreads to other rooms.
Lake community vacation rentals in Burlington County face the same risks as any high-turnover rental: repeated guest stays create repeated opportunities for bed bug introduction. Remove the property from rental platforms immediately and schedule a professional inspection. Once cleared, consider proactive inspections between bookings during peak season to stay ahead of the problem.
Affordable housing operators in Burlington County are held to the same habitability standards as any landlord in New Jersey. When a tenant reports bed bugs, respond in writing, schedule a professional inspection within a few days, and treat immediately if activity is confirmed. Documenting your response process carefully is important for regulatory compliance and protects you in any tenant dispute.
